A Stillwater-based senior housing developer has proposed a 100- to 120-unit senior housing project on land in Elk River once owned by the United States Postal Service.
Hearth Development paid $1.4 million for the 4.5-acre vacant site on the northeast corner of Line Avenue and 181st Avenue and closed on the sale on May 5.
A couple of weeks before that, Hearth was at Elk River City Council work session to informally present its proposal.
